Full Job Description
Eaton's IS AER FED division is currently seeking a Lead Manufacturing Engineer. This position will be located at our Middlesex, NC facility. Relocation benefits will be provided within the United States only.

The Lead Manufacturing Engineer will manage multiple large-scale projects within the plant to help meet business objectives such as cost out, safety, productivity, scrap, yield, and Industry 4.0 objectives. In this role, you will work closely with the Engineering Manager to create and execute capital strategy and support engineering functional team members on capital initiatives and day-to-day manufacturing engineer tasks.

The expected annual salary range for this role is $97000 - $143000 a year.

Please note the salary information shown above is a general guideline only. Salaries are based upon candidate skills, experience, and qualifications, as well as market and business considerations.

What you'll do:
• Lead efforts to proactively identify opportunities and drive improvements that positively impact safety, quality, delivery and productivity and cost.
• Proactively identify, create, and manage capital projects to completion. Complete cost justification, appropriation requests and validate factory cost-out.
• Develop technology roadmap and implementation plan to support industry 4.0 objectives.
• Define manufacturing documentation, including operator method sheets (work instructions), standard work, and other instructions.
• Identify and implement new manufacturing processes and methods to reduce cost, enhance safety and improve delivery.
• Launch new products and processes using Pro-Launch and PPAP tools. Create, review and approve product and process change reports necessary to gain customer approval.
• Establish, maintain, and audit Engineering Specifications, Bills of Material, Process Routers, Production Standards, and Process FMEA's for new and existing processes and products.
• Participate with multi-functional product and process development teams to ensure manufacturability through the Pro-Launch process and identify resource needs for the plant, assist in preparing budgets and major appropriation requests.
• Assist in evaluation of potential and existing suppliers and provide support to suppliers as needed.
• Provide day-to-day support for the manufacturing team, including investigating, analyzing and troubleshooting for product design, materials, tooling, equipment, production methods and processes.
• Foster an environment that promotes Eaton's goals and philosophies and encourages continuous improvement through participation and teamwork (e.g. rapid improvement events, 5S+ audits, poka-yoke).
• Maintain a safe working environment. Abide by all safety requirements. Design safety into every process and activity. (e.g. leading Eaton MESH element).
• Follow Eaton code of ethics, harassment free workplace policy, and leadership model to help create a respectful and high performing work environment.
• Complete other related duties as assigned.

About EATON

Eaton Corporation plc is a multinational power management company with 2020 sales of $17.9 billion, founded in the US. Eaton provides energy-efficient solutions that help customers effectively manage electrical, hydraulic, and mechanical power more efficiently, safely, and sustainably. Eaton operates through three main business segments: Electrical Products, Electrical Systems and Services, and Hydraulics. The Electrical Products segment designs, manufactures, markets, and sells electrical components, such as circuit breakers, switches, and electrical protection and control devices. The Electrical Systems and Services segment offers electrical power distribution and assemblies, as well as engineering services and automation and control solutions. The Hydraulics segment provides products such as pumps, motors, valves, cylinders, and filtration products. Eaton has a global presence with operations in North America, Europe, Asia, and other regions.
